Comprehensive Explanation of the Topic
Vintage signed designer jewelry refers to pieces created by renowned designers from past eras. These pieces often bear the signature or hallmark of the designer, adding authenticity and value to the jewelry. The craftsmanship and attention to detail in vintage signed designer jewelry set them apart from modern pieces, making them highly sought after by collectors.
Each piece of vintage signed designer jewelry tells a story, reflecting the style and trends of its time. Whether it's a sparkling diamond brooch from the Art Deco period or a colorful enamel bracelet from the 1960s, these pieces capture the essence of a bygone era and showcase the creativity of the designer.
Advanced Insights and Important Details
When purchasing vintage signed designer jewelry, it's essential to authenticate the piece and verify its provenance. Look for signatures, hallmarks, and other identifying marks that indicate the piece is genuine. Consulting with reputable dealers or experts can help ensure you are investing in a true heirloom piece.
In addition to authenticity, consider the condition of the vintage jewelry. Vintage pieces may show signs of wear due to age, but minor wear can add to the charm and character of the piece. However, significant damage or alterations can affect the value and collectibility of the jewelry.

Challenges, Misconceptions, and Risks
One of the challenges of buying vintage signed designer jewelry is navigating the market and identifying authentic pieces. With the rise of counterfeit jewelry and replicas, buyers must be vigilant and do their research to avoid purchasing fake pieces. Educating yourself on the hallmarks and signatures of different designers can help you make informed decisions.

Is vintage signed designer jewelry expensive?
Vintage signed designer jewelry can range in price depending on the designer, materials, and condition of the piece. While some pieces may be more affordable, rare and sought-after pieces can command high prices.
How can I authenticate vintage signed designer jewelry?
Authenticating vintage jewelry involves examining the hallmarks, signatures, and materials used in the piece. Consulting with experts or reputable dealers can help verify the authenticity of the jewelry.
Are there specific eras that are more collectible in vintage jewelry?
Certain eras, such as Art Deco, Retro, and Mid-Century Modern, are highly collectible in the world of vintage jewelry. Each era has its unique style and design elements that appeal to collectors.
Can I wear vintage signed designer jewelry every day?
While vintage jewelry is durable, it is best to exercise caution when wearing it daily. Avoid exposing vintage pieces to harsh chemicals, excessive heat, or moisture to preserve their condition.
Where can I find vintage signed designer jewelry for sale?
You can find vintage signed designer jewelry at antique shops, estate sales, online auctions, and reputable jewelry dealers. Take your time to research and explore different sources to find the perfect piece for your collection.
